Hash tables are one of the oldest and simplest data structures for storing elements and supporting deletions and queries. Invented in 1953, they underly most computational systems. Yet despite their ...
High function, low cost—serious woodworking starts here. In this practical DIY project, I’ll show you how to transform a simple IKEA countertop into a fully functional double router table, perfect for ...
The original version of this story appeared in Quanta Magazine. Sometime in the fall of 2021, Andrew Krapivin, an undergraduate at Rutgers University, encountered a paper that would change his life.
A young computer scientist and two colleagues show that searches within data structures called hash tables can be much faster than previously deemed possible. Sometime in the fall of 2021, Andrew ...
Double hashing is designed to reduce clustering. It does this by calculating the stride for a given key using a second, independent hash function. Thus, two objects will have the same probe sequence ...
As we have seen in previous videos, it happens sometimes that two keys yield the same hash value for a given table size. This is called a “hash collision” or just “collision.” Why do hash collisions ...
Throughout the history of the WNBA, there have only been two triple-doubles recorded by a rookie. Both of those belong to Indiana Fever superstar Caitlin Clark. Clark made history earlier this season ...
Seventy years after the invention of a data structure called a hash table, theoreticians have found the most efficient possible configuration for it. About 70 years ago, an engineer at IBM named Hans ...
一些您可能无法访问的结果已被隐去。
显示无法访问的结果